The Growth Hormone Releasing Peptide, In Plain Words

You might have heard about sermorelin acetate, a synthetic peptide that mimics a naturally occurring hormone. It functions as a growth hormone releasing hormone (GHRH) analog. This means it signals your pituitary gland to release more growth hormone in a natural, pulsatile manner, similar to how your body worked when you were younger. This process is distinct from synthetic human growth hormone injections.

This therapy supports your body’s own production of IGF-1 (Insulin-like Growth Factor-1), a critical hormone for cell regeneration, muscle growth, and fat metabolism. As we age, our natural growth hormone levels decline, impacting these functions. By stimulating your pituitary, this compounded prescription aims to restore more youthful hormone levels, potentially leading to improved sleep quality, increased energy, and better body composition. Many patients report enhanced recovery times after exercise or injury when undergoing this treatment.

The therapy involves a series of subcutaneous injections, typically administered daily. A licensed US clinician determines the appropriate dosage and treatment plan based on your individual health profile and lab results. This approach focuses on supporting your body’s natural endocrine system rather than directly administering a hormone.

Frequently Asked Questions About Peptide Therapy

Is sermorelin FDA-approved

Compounded sermorelin acetate is not FDA-approved as a distinct drug. It is manufactured and dispensed under USP and compounding regulations. This means it is prepared by licensed pharmacies based on a physician’s prescription for individual patients, not mass-produced for general sale.

How does this therapy differ from HGH

This GHRH analog works by stimulating your pituitary gland to produce its own natural growth hormone. Synthetic human growth hormone (HGH) injections directly introduce the hormone into your body. The pulsatile, natural release stimulated by sermorelin is often considered a more physiological approach.

What lab tests are usually required

Typical lab tests include IGF-1 levels, fasting glucose, and sometimes checks for thyroid function and lipid panels. These help the clinician assess your current hormonal status and overall health to determine the appropriate treatment plan and dosage.

Can I get a prescription without a consultation

No, a prescription for compounded sermorelin acetate can only be issued after a thorough consultation with a licensed medical professional. This consultation ensures the therapy is safe and medically necessary for your specific health needs.

How long does treatment typically last

Treatment duration varies greatly among individuals. Many patients continue therapy for several months to achieve their desired results. Your clinician will work with you to develop a long-term plan that supports your continued well-being.
